
This July, our Community Groups are taking four weeks to walk through the 321 Course together. Normally, our groups spend time discussing and applying the passage of Scripture from the previous Sunday’s sermon. During the month of July, we are setting aside that regular rhythm for a simple, thoughtful, and honest introduction to the Christian faith. The 321 Course helps us consider some of life’s biggest questions through the lens of Jesus: Who is God? What is the world like? Who are we? And what does Jesus invite us into? Each week will include short videos, group discussion, and space for honest questions. Whether you are a Christian wanting to grow in your understanding of the gospel and how to talk about it with others, someone newer to faith, or a skeptic who is open to exploring Christianity, this is a great place to come, listen, and process in community.
